Sappington Bridge: A Guide to This Bourbon, Missouri Landmark
Sappington Bridge, located at 2950-3198 Sappington Bridge Rd, Bourbon, MO 65441, United States, is a notable landmark in the area. Known for its essential role in water-based activities, this bridge serves as a crucial entry and exit point for individuals embarking on canoe, kayak, or other watercraft trips along the Meramac River.

Location and Access
Sappington Bridge is situated along Sappington Bridge Road in Bourbon, Missouri. Visitors can easily access the area via car, with ample parking available on-site. While there are no specific public transportation options directly to the site, the nearby Meramac River offers opportunities for boat transportation as well.
Featured Characteristics
The bridge itself is a sturdy and reliable structure, built to withstand the elements and provide a safe passage for those traversing the Meramac River. Its unique location makes it an ideal spot for launching or retrieving watercraft, with easy access to the river's banks.
Practical Information
Visitors to Sappington Bridge can expect a well-maintained parking lot with ample space for cars. While there may be occasional crowding on weekends, the bridge remains a popular spot for water-based activities in the area. It is recommended to arrive early to secure a parking spot during peak times.
